AC EV Charging Gun Series Energy Saving Burn In Cabinet
High-efficiency energy-saving burn-in cabinet designed for AC EV charging gun series testing, featuring advanced energy recovery technology and modular design.

Burn-In Cabinet Structure
| Specification | Details |
|---|---|
| Trolley Size | L2100 * W1500 * H1800mm (single cabinet dimensions) |
| Trolley Layers | 2 layers with 450mm product area depth (6 burn-in positions per layer) |
| Trolley Height | 450mm |
| Construction Material | Cold rolled sheet |
| Heat Dissipation | Top turbine exhaust fan (easy ambient temperature control) |
| Insulation Method | Epoxy insulation board with surface heat dissipation holes |
| Overall Structure | Mobile burn-in split cabinet - aesthetically designed for easy movement and combination |
Energy Recovery Module Configuration
- Control Mode: RS485 communication with RS232 upper computer interface
- Burn-In Process: Relative drag method for product testing
- Energy Modules: 4 installed load modules
- Load Isolation: Isolated load design
- Module Architecture: Relay-free, long-life design (proprietary technology)
- Capacity: 24 units of ≤22KW charging piles per cabinet (compatible with lower power units)
- Connection Standards: Supports National, European, American, and Tesla regulations
